I was instructed to disconnect from the Net, disable "system restore" then do a new scan. Apparently the worm/virus has found a way to hide in any previous "system restores", by disabling restore, the PC removes ALL restore points and the virus has nothing to attach to.

ZA, AVG, Spybot, Adaware and Spysubtract have all deemed the PC infection free.
